Background technique
With the development of computer technology and the arrival of the internet of things era, city management and life are to various common equipments The cry of " wisdom " is also higher and higher.In the management and construction of smart city, there are all kinds of common equipments being distributed in city to need Smart city management and monitoring is added, such as telecommunication apparatus case, dustbin, water tower, telephone booth etc. are various inner space Communal facility, monitoring management situations such as to the capacity, air, fire of its inside.For example, city public garbage bin management and function On energy subdivision field, there are many more mature dustbin products in each state.For example, BigBelly Solar company of the U.S. opens The solar energy dustbin of a entitled BigBelly has been sent out, there is solar powered, Efficient Compression, Internet of Things Network Communication, WIFI heat The functions such as point;Also there is a dustbin VAJRA under domestic Qi Yue scientific & technical corporation, be equipped with solar battery, display screen, positioning Module and Android system carry out wisdom management.The greatest problem that these dustbins encounter in extension process is cost and sells Valence is high, for example, BigBelly price in 8000 U.S. dollars or so, and if to realize municipal refuse bucket management need pair Original dustbin is replaced on a large scale, and project amount is huge.
The dustbin Enevo ONe Collect of one Enevo company of Finland to it is some on dustbin realize China without Real function is deleted, and is slightly reduced in cost and price, but large-scale promotion uses and still faces same problem. Other communal facilitys there is also manage identical problem with dustbin.

The sensing module 24, with the processing module 21 be electrically connected comprising inertial sensor, concentration sensor, One of gas detection sensor, temperature sensor and capacity sensor or multiple combinations, for acquiring environmental information.Specifically Inertial sensor be used to incude the displacement of public utility, such as the situations such as sharp impacts, stolen occur;Concentration sensor is gentle Body sensor is used to incude the concentration or type of the hazardous gas inside public utility;Temperature sensor is for incuding public utility Internal temperature;Capacity sensor is used to incude the spatial content inside public utility.For different demand and application scenarios, Different sensors can be matched, such as in the facility (such as dustbin, telecommunication apparatus case) for having inflammable monitoring, can be selected Concentration sensor, gas detection sensor, temperature sensor.
The type of the capacity sensor includes: ultrasonic wave, at least one of infrared and laser sensor etc.;It is described The type of temperature sensor includes: at least one of thermal resistance and thermocouple sensor etc.;The gas detection sensor Type includes: at least one of metal-oxide semiconductor (MOS) formula sensor and fixed electric potential electroanalysis formula gas sensor etc.;It is described The type of concentration sensor includes: at least one of catalytic type and infrared optics type sensor etc.;The inertial sensor Type includes: at least one of acceleration transducer and angular-rate sensor etc..

In one embodiment of the invention, in the sensing module acquisition bucket environmental information and by the communication module to External equipment is sent, and the environmental information may include: to acquire the displacement information from the dustbin of inertial sensor, acquire from dense Flammable explosive gas concentration information in the bucket of sensor is spent, the temperature within the barrel information from temperature sensor is acquired, acquires from gas One or more groups of remaining space etc. in the bucket composition of gases within information of detection sensor and the bucket of acquisition self-capacity sensor It closes, those information can show monitoring personnel to check;Wherein, it can be analyzed from the flammable explosive gas concentration information inflammable The detection of explosion hazard gases realizes the prevention to explosion, it is of course also possible to cooperate the temperature within the barrel information and gas composition information To keep analysis result more accurate;In addition, also may determine that in bucket from the temperature within the barrel information whether occur catching fire it is tight Anxious situation.
In one embodiment of the invention, the sensing module of the monitoring accessory includes capacity sensor, such as;The appearance Quantity sensor can detecte it to the spacing of rubbish in bucket, and generate respective distances signal;The processing module, for according to institute State distance signal calculate bucket in rubbish filling extent, and in the bucket rubbish filling extent be greater than preset threshold when, generation mentions Show signal;The communication module, for sending the standby signal to external equipment;It is of course also possible to which only distance signal is led to It crosses and is sent to calculating and subsequent prompt operation that external equipment carries out rubbish filling extent in bucket outside the communication module, not It must be completed by the processing module in monitoring accessory.
